Partner (Permanent) Visa — Onshore.
The Partner (Permanent) visa (subclass 801) is the permanent stage of Australia's onshore partner migration pathway, granted to subclass 820 holders once the Department of Home Affairs confirms the relationship remains genuine — typically two years after the combined 820/801 application was lodged.
The 801 grants the right to live, work, and study in Australia indefinitely, access Medicare, and apply for citizenship. The application fee — paid upfront at the 820/801 lodgement stage — is AUD 9,365 for most applicants. Once qualifying, the 801 stage typically takes 16 to 22 months to finalise.
This visa is ideal for foreign nationals already in Australia on a subclass 820 who have maintained a genuine, continuing relationship with their Australian sponsor.

Must hold a temporary Partner visa (subclass 820).
Must still be in a genuine and ongoing relationship with the original sponsor (unless specific exceptions like domestic violence or death of the sponsor apply).
Must continue to meet health and character requirements.
Must have no outstanding debts to the Australian Government.
Generally, at least two years must have passed since the initial 820/801 application was lodged.
Must be in the best interests of any children involved.
Updated evidence of a genuine and ongoing relationship since the 820 grant
Current passport biodata page
New Australian Federal Police check
Updated Form 888 statutory declarations (if requested)
Evidence of shared financial commitments and household responsibilities
Updated sponsorship statement/form
Any relevant changes in circumstances (e.g., birth of children, change of address)
